Honk!

    (Fantagraphics, 1986-1987)
™ and © Fantagraphics Books, Inc.

Honk! was Fantagraphics’ attempt to do something in the mold of Mad but with one critical difference. In between the typical humorous comic book stories and parodies, a serious interview with a prominent cartoonist of the day was featured with many examples of their work. Cartoonists include Don Martin, Matt Groening, and Bill Watterson discussing their varied experience in comic books, comic strips and animation. The series was very well received, but short-lived as Fantagraphics soon canceled this with the impossibly titled Centrifugal Bumble Puppy, which was essentially the same magazine minus the interviews.

— Mark Arnold
